What is a Transponder Key?
The word "transponder" is a combination of "transmitter" and "responder." A transponder key is a car key equipped with a small, embedded microchip—often a glass or plastic capsule located within the plastic bow of the key. This chip emits a low-frequency signal. When you insert the key into the ignition or bring it near the start button in modern vehicles, the car's immobilizer system sends out a radio signal to the key.
The transponder chip is powered by this signal and responds by sending its own unique identification code back to the vehicle's Engine Control Unit (ECU). If the code matches the one stored in the car's system, the ECU allows the fuel system and ignition to activate. If the code is incorrect or missing, the car will either not start at all or will stall after a few seconds of running. This technology has drastically reduced the rate of hot-wiring, as cutting and joining wires cannot bypass the digital handshake required between the key and the car.
The Difference Between a Standard Key and a Transponder Key
Visually, a transponder key might look identical to a standard metal key, especially in older models where the plastic head is slightly larger. However, the difference lies entirely inside. A standard key is just a piece of metal cut to match the mechanical locks. A transponder key contains that vital electronic component. If you were to cut a blank transponder key to the correct physical shape for your car but skip the programming step, the key would turn the lock cylinder but the engine would not start. This is a common point of confusion for drivers who assume that once a key is cut, it should work immediately.
The Importance of Professional Transponder Key Programming
This brings us to the most critical aspect of transponder car key services: programming. Programming is the process of teaching your vehicle to recognize the unique serial number of a new transponder chip. It is not a simple DIY task that can be done with basic tools from a hardware store.
Modern vehicles have sophisticated security protocols. In many cases, programming a new key requires specialized diagnostic equipment that can communicate with the car's computer system. This equipment often needs security codes or PINs that are unique to your vehicle's make and model. Attempting to program a key without this equipment, or using low-quality aftermarket parts, can sometimes lead to the immobilizer system locking up entirely, resulting in a more expensive repair.

Common Scenarios Requiring Transponder Services
There are several situations where you might need to utilize transponder key programming services:
Lost or Stolen Keys: This is the most urgent scenario. When keys go missing, it is not just about getting back into the car; it is about security. A professional can deactivate the lost key's code from the vehicle's system so that even if someone finds it, they cannot start your car. They can then cut and program a brand new key for you.
Broken or Malfunctioning Key: The transponder chip is durable, but it is not invincible. Exposure to water, physical impact from dropping the key, or simply age can cause the chip to fail. Sometimes, the issue lies with the car's antenna ring that reads the key. A diagnostic service can pinpoint whether the problem is the key or the vehicle.
Wear and Tear: Mechanical keys and ignition cylinders wear down over time. If your key is getting stuck or requires jiggling to turn, it might be wearing out the cuts. In these cases, you might need a new key cut to the original factory specifications, which then also needs to be programmed to match the immobilizer. Smart Keys and Proximity Fobs: Modern vehicles are increasingly using "smart" keys or keyless entry fobs. These operate on a similar principle but use a two-way communication system. If the battery in your fob dies, or if the fob is damaged, the car may not recognize you. Programming these fobs is even more complex, often requiring the technician to sync the fob's ID to the car's Body Control Module.
